BRINGING BEN HOME A Murder, a Conviction, and the Fight to Redeem American Justice

by | Read by Barbara Bradley Hagerty

Contemporary Culture • 14.5 hrs. • Unabridged • © 2024

Barbara Bradley Hagerty narrates her audiobook in a clear tone that is refreshingly free of nonsense. Hagerty recounts the story of the wrongful conviction of Ben Spencer for murder and carjacking. After questionable witness testimony and the prosecutor's need to secure a conviction, Spencer spent decades in prison despite mounting evidence that should have exonerated him. While Hagerty identifies some key figures who prevented Spencer from gaining his freedom sooner, she also dissects the deeply flawed legal system that all but prohibits access to equity and justice. This detailed critique targets fundamental flaws in the way trials are conducted: biased testimony, strategic jury selection, and systemic evidence suppression. Hagerty's confident yet subdued tone ensures that Spencer's story and her compelling research remain front and center. S.P.C. © AudioFile 2024, Portland, Maine [Published: OCTOBER 2024]
